The Best Times for Stargazing in Highland Lakes

In AL, the transitional periods of early Winter often provide a stable atmosphere between weather fronts. For Highland Lakes residents, this means less 'star twinkling' (scintillation) and a significantly steadier view for high-magnification planetary observation.

If you're visiting verified local spots, bring a pack of chemical hand-warmers and rubber-band them to your eyepiece or camera lens. This acts as a 'budget' dew heater, which is essential for the humid nights often found in AL during the peak viewing seasons.
